About me

Hello. My name is Emily and have been counseling in South Carolina for 11 years. I am extremely passionate about building working relationships to validate, empower and encourage people who want to address issues they may be struggling with. My main goals is to create a safe, comfortable environment where one can share openly without fear of judgment, rejection or ridicule. Identifying feelings and being able to share with an unbiased person helps one to realize that your pain is your pain regardless of what other people may be dealing with. I have experience working with trauma, abuse (verbal,physical, mental, emotional), addiction, domestic violence, relationships and bipolar disorder.
I would love the opportunity to help you by listening empathetically while providing compassion, insight and tools that are specific to you and your needs.
Give yourself credit for seeking help as it is hard to ask for help and share our struggles and pains with someone. I am excited for you and hope that you can gain some tools and insight by finding the right person to talk to. I look forward to the opportunity to help you with the rewards that can be gained in counseling.
